What is 13F institutional ownership?

SEC Form 13F is a quarterly report filed by institutional investment managers with over $100M in qualifying assets. It discloses their US equity holdings, providing transparency into what the largest investors are buying and selling.

How often is institutional ownership data updated?

13F filings are due 45 days after each calendar quarter end (May 15, Aug 14, Nov 14, Feb 14). Data is updated on HedgeTrace as new filings are processed.
